When did the term learning disability start?

1963. The term learning disabilities was first introduced when a small group of parents and educators met in Chicago at the Palmer House. The term was proposed by Dr. Samuel A.

When did learning disability begin?

In the US, LD was introduced and listed in the agenda of the Federal Government. In that, the Federal Government mandated in 1969 to develop the field of learning disabilities to be a distinct entity within special education (Hammill, 1993).

Do we still use the term learning disability?

Not only is the term learning disability recognized by state and federal governments, it is the preferred term of many advocacy organizations (including the Learning Disability Association of America). Far more people search online for learning disability related information and resources.

What are the 4 types of learning disabilities?

Learning disabilities usually fall within four broad categories:

  • Spoken language-listening and speaking.
  • Written language-reading, writing, and spelling.
  • Arithmetic-calculation and concepts.
  • Reasoning-organization and integration of ideas and thoughts.

What are 3 known causes of learning disabilities?

What causes a learning disability?

  • the mother becoming ill in pregnancy.
  • problems during the birth that stop enough oxygen getting to the brain.
  • the unborn baby having some genes passed on from its parents that make having a learning disability more likely.
  • illness, such as meningitis, or injury in early childhood.

How are learning disabilities discovered?

Learning disabilities are often identified once a child is in school. The school may use a process called “response to intervention” to help identify children with learning disabilities. Special tests are required to make a diagnosis.

What is the definition of learning disability?

Learning disabilities are disorders that affect the ability to understand or use spoken or written language, do mathematical calculations, coordinate movements, or direct attention. Although learning disabilities occur in very young children, the disorders are usually not recognized until the child reaches school age.

Can ADHD cause a learning disability?

ADHD can affect learning, but it is not a learning disability. Some challenging effects of the condition, such as difficulty concentrating and hyperactivity, may impact a person's ability to learn.

What is the difference between learning disability and learning difficulty?

a learning disability constitutes a condition which affects learning and intelligence across all areas of life. a learning difficulty constitutes a condition which creates an obstacle to a specific form of learning, but does not affect the overall IQ of an individual.

Is autism a learning disability?

Like a learning disability, autism is a lifelong condition. Autism is sometimes referred to as a spectrum, or autism spectrum disorder (ASD). Autism is not a learning disability, but around half of autistic people may also have a learning disability.

What are 4 signs of learning disabilities?

Common signs that a person may have learning disabilities include the following:

  • Problems reading and/or writing.
  • Problems with math.
  • Poor memory.
  • Problems paying attention.
  • Trouble following directions.
  • Clumsiness.
  • Trouble telling time.
  • Problems staying organized.
